Lewandowski says he has lost motivation due to Aubameyang’s Arsenal Move
Bayern Munich striker, Robert Lewandowski, has admitted losing some of his motivation, following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ang’s move from Borussia Dortmund to Arsenal in January.
Aubameyang, last season’s Bundesliga top scorer, left for the Emirates in a £56million deal.
The two forwards spent a year together at Dortmund, before Lewandowski joined Bayern in 2014.
Since then, they have been rivals for the highest goal scorer in Bundesliga.
Lewandowski bagged 30 goals in 2015/2016 to land the top scorer title, before Aubameyang notched a final day brace last season to take the title by a goal (31 to 30).
“For the last three years I’ve competed with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ang to be the top scorer.
“Now that he’s gone, maybe a part of my motivation that came from our duel has also gone.
“Obviously, when you have that rivalry, you’re a bit more motivated,” Lewandowski said.
